On Saturday at the central bank annual meeting, the Governor of the Bank of Japan, Haruhiko Kuroda, reiterated his accommodative stance, but the market expects a policy tightening. Japanese investors may sell foreign bonds and repatriate funds, accelerating the global bond sell-off.
